How can I increase my emotional intelligence? This is a question that many individuals ponder, as emotional intelligence (EQ) plays a crucial role in personal and professional success. Emotional intelligence refers to the ability to recognize, understand, and manage our own emotions, as well as the emotions of others. By enhancing our emotional intelligence, we can improve our relationships, communication skills, and overall well-being. In this article, we will explore various strategies to help you boost your emotional intelligence and become a more empathetic and effective individual.

Firstly, self-awareness is the foundation of emotional intelligence. To increase your self-awareness, take time to reflect on your emotions and the reasons behind them. Keep a journal to track your feelings and thoughts, which can help you identify patterns and triggers. Recognizing your emotions is the first step in managing them effectively.

Secondly, practice mindfulness. Mindfulness involves staying present and fully engaging with the here and now. By being mindful, you can become more aware of your emotions and reactions in real-time, allowing you to respond rather than react impulsively. Mindfulness exercises, such as meditation or deep breathing techniques, can help you develop this skill.

Another essential aspect of emotional intelligence is empathy. To increase your empathy, try to put yourself in others’ shoes and understand their perspectives. Active listening is a valuable tool for developing empathy. When someone shares their feelings or experiences, give them your full attention, nod, and acknowledge their emotions. This can help build trust and strengthen your relationships.

Developing emotional regulation is also crucial for enhancing your emotional intelligence. Learn to control your reactions to stressful situations and manage your emotions effectively. This can be achieved through stress management techniques, such as exercise, relaxation techniques, or seeking support from friends and family. By developing emotional regulation, you can become more resilient and better equipped to handle life’s challenges.

Additionally, communication skills play a significant role in emotional intelligence. Work on improving your active listening, non-verbal communication, and conflict resolution skills. Clear and open communication can help prevent misunderstandings and foster stronger relationships. Consider taking workshops or courses on effective communication to enhance your skills.

Lastly, surround yourself with positive influences. Seek out friends, mentors, and role models who demonstrate high emotional intelligence. Observing and learning from others can provide valuable insights and inspiration for your own growth. Joining support groups or attending events focused on emotional intelligence can also offer networking opportunities and additional resources.
